Pros

Good opportunities for young people, especially if they know German. Most people use it as way to get to better jobs later on. People need to come aboard knowing that they will make sacrifices. Salary is above average in nearly every department.

Cons

A lot of work, nearly every department is short-staffed because of high productivity demands. It's a good company if you want to earn money and learn a lot in a short period of time, just be sure that you are willing to make sacrifices.
